Handover: Meridel calendar sync still double-books when two upstream feeds disagree on timezone offsets. Conflict resolver picks the earlier event; that's intentional, don't "fix" it. Watch the retry queue after each feed refresh. Tovan owns the upstream side now. The resolver reads everything below at startup, so change with care.

settings of yageg-yahap:
[gorael]
team = olieth
access_code = ac_941d74
owner = brieth.aldiel
host = gorael.tolvaqio.internal
port = 6379
peer = briwyn.urlaqtech.internal
salt = 116e6622
pin = 1957

## Break-Glass: Cold Storage Archival

Hey support folks — sometimes Glacierbox cold buckets need archiving outside the normal Frostline pipeline (usually when a tenant offboards mid-cycle). That's break-glass territory. First, ping the on-call lead in the escalation channel and get a verbal OK. Then open the sealed runbook in the ops vault, run the archive script, and file a post-action note within 24 hours. The vault itself is locked; to open it in an emergency, use the passphrase below.

recovery phrase for tagug-yagug: lamox-gilax-keleth-gilath

Pinning policy (Quarrel service): all direct deps pinned to exact versions in the lockfile. Transitive drift is caught nightly by the Hollowmark scanner. Never use ranges in production manifests. Upgrades go through a dedicated PR with scanner output attached. When re-pinning, record the verified build against which the lockfile was regenerated below.

trace token, fafog-kageg: htk4_98e6

### Deep-Link Routing — Runbook Fragment

The Orvello mobile app resolves deep links through the Linkgate service. If users report links opening the web fallback instead of the app, verify DEEPLINK_SCHEME matches the build flavor and that LINKGATE_TIMEOUT_MS has not been lowered below 800. Routing decisions are signed to prevent tampering, and Linkgate rejects unsigned payloads outright. The signing secret used for this check is defined on the next line of the environment file.

secret setting of hawep-yahig: LEDGER_TOKEN29=41b5d6315371c92885eaeb077fb63